Quote:
Originally Posted by Shagaliscious View Post
Wow, some of you have a lot more coverage then I do for bodily injury. I only have $15k/$30k...
You should really get more than just the state minimum. At least contact your carrier and get quotes for the next step up. I work in insurance, and a lot of times, the differences in price for higher coverage limits ends up not being a lot. Personally I have $1.5 million in liability coverage myself.

Quote:
Originally Posted by Got3n View Post
Liability - Bodily Injury $500,000 each person / $500,000 each accident
Liability - Property Damage $100,000 each accident
Personal Injury Protection (PIP) $5,000
Uninsured/Underinsured Motorist - Bodily Injury $100,000 each person / $300,000 each accident
Other Than Collision Deductible - $50
Collision Deductible $500
Towing and Labor Costs Yes
Rental Reimbursement $35/Day Max $1,050

129/mnth
Good coverages... if it's offered by your company, since you have those limits, you might want to consider a 500 CSL rather than 500/500/100. That's what I have, though I added a $1 million umbrella policy.
